| #ifndef __OSMO_CONV_H__ |
| #define __OSMO_CONV_H__ |
| |
| #include <stdint.h> |
| |
| #include <osmocom/core/bits.h> |
| |
| struct osmo_conv_code { |
| int N; |
| int K; |
| int len; |
| |
| const uint8_t (*next_output)[2]; |
| const uint8_t (*next_state)[2]; |
| |
| const uint8_t *next_term_output; |
| const uint8_t *next_term_state; |
| |
| const int *puncture; |
| }; |
| |
| |
| /* Encoding */ |
| |
| /* Low level API */ |
| struct osmo_conv_encoder { |
| const struct osmo_conv_code *code; |
| int i_idx; /* Next input bit index */ |
| int p_idx; /* Current puncture index */ |
| uint8_t state; /* Current state */ |
| }; |
| |
| void osmo_conv_encode_init(struct osmo_conv_encoder *encoder, |
| const struct osmo_conv_code *code); |
| int osmo_conv_encode_raw(struct osmo_conv_encoder *encoder, |
| const ubit_t *input, ubit_t *output, int n); |
| int osmo_conv_encode_finish(struct osmo_conv_encoder *encoder, ubit_t *output); |
| |
| /* All-in-one */ |
| int osmo_conv_encode(const struct osmo_conv_code *code, |
| const ubit_t *input, ubit_t *output); |
| |
| |
| /* Decoding */ |
| |
| /* Low level API */ |
| struct osmo_conv_decoder { |
| const struct osmo_conv_code *code; |
| |
| int n_states; |
| |
| int len; /* Max o_idx (excl. termination) */ |
| |
| int o_idx; /* output index */ |
| int p_idx; /* puncture index */ |
| |
| unsigned int *ae; /* accumulater error */ |
| unsigned int *ae_next; /* next accumulated error (tmp in scan) */ |
| uint8_t *state_history; /* state history [len][n_states] */ |
| }; |
| |
| void osmo_conv_decode_init(struct osmo_conv_decoder *decoder, |
| const struct osmo_conv_code *code, int len); |
| void osmo_conv_decode_reset(struct osmo_conv_decoder *decoder); |
| void osmo_conv_decode_deinit(struct osmo_conv_decoder *decoder); |
| |
| int osmo_conv_decode_scan(struct osmo_conv_decoder *decoder, |
| const sbit_t *input, int n); |
| int osmo_conv_decode_finish(struct osmo_conv_decoder *decoder, |
| const sbit_t *input); |
| int osmo_conv_decode_get_output(struct osmo_conv_decoder *decoder, |
| ubit_t *output, int has_finish); |
| |
| /* All-in-one */ |
| int osmo_conv_decode(const struct osmo_conv_code *code, |
| const sbit_t *input, ubit_t *output); |
| |
| |
| #endif /* __OSMO_CONV_H__ */ |
